The winners of yesteryear include Atayne, which was a runner-up last week in Gorham Savings Bank’s LaunchPad business plan competition; Flyte New Media; Liquid Wireless; and Bite Into Maine, the food truck famous throughout the country now for its lobster rolls. Those nominated will receive an application, and the winner is chosen at an annual event. This year it will take place on Wed., June 12, 2013, at Grace Restaurant in Portland.

Here are the official nomination guidelines:

• Business must be for-profit and located in southern Maine
• Business has been operating for a minimum of 6 months
• Business plan is scalable
• Business has a proven commitment to the people, place and prosperity of Maine
• Business would benefit from receiving a prize package of support services
